2020 Inclement Weather Information
December 16, 2020 -
Four inclement weather days are built into the 2020-2021 school calendar. If these days are not used, the school year will end earlier than June 17, currently the last day of school.
If more than four days are used, the school year will be extended by the number of days used.
In an effort to avoid using inclement weather days this year, CCPS has developed the following plan:
1. If a weather event impacts the ability to transport students safely:
a. All students will remain at home for an asynchronous distancing learning day (as they
experience on Wednesdays). Asynchronous lessons will be posted by 10:30 am.
b. Staff will report for a 10:00 am start time.
2. If a weather event requires the closure of all CCPS buildings:
a. All students will remain at home for an asynchronous distancing learning day (as they
experience on Wednesdays). Asynchronous lessons will be posted by 10:30 am.
b. Staff do not report.
Unexpected inclement weather may result in an early dismissal for in-person students and staff. An early dismissal would impact the schedule for both in-person students and distance learners; however, it would generally not have an impact on the school calendar.
